Inmarsat signs Radio Holland agreement

Inmarsat has signed a service and installation agreement with Radio Holland to support customer demand for rapid migration from XpressLink to Fleet Xpress services.
The non-exclusive agreement augments Inmarsat’s existing service partner and VAR arrangements, reflecting a specific need to draw on the extensive Radio Holland support network to accelerate the installation of Fleet Xpress on a global scale.
“Fleet Xpress is currently installed at a rate of around 150 vessels every month, with the split being half new installations and half upgrades,” explained Trond Leira, senior vice president of service delivery and customer support at Inmarsat.
She concluded: “We expect this number to increase in 2017 and our priority is to ensure that installation of Fleet Xpress keeps pace with demand. The agreement with Radio Holland extends the Inmarsat service network and brings access to a pool of experienced, skilled engineers in the world’s busiest ports.”
